Transaction 1843e3321069d8e1d16c85143a8de2faf8d39565e80b61ab946e9a64f539d7da

1 Input
2 Outputs
  • 1843e3321069d8e1d16c85143a8de2faf8d39565e80b61ab946e9a64f539d7da:0
  • value  358728
    address  12SGT8hY69cfUQGeQFavC72xnHxnwWj5ai
  • 1843e3321069d8e1d16c85143a8de2faf8d39565e80b61ab946e9a64f539d7da:1
  • value  2599
    address  3F5rQ9eSmgPBB1R5HUU8MubnvEFWg7N4Qz